Enterprise and mid-market teams protecting critical OT infrastructure from IT-sourced malware will get the most from OPSWAT MetaDefender NetWall because its hardware-enforced unidirectional data flow eliminates the attack surface entirely, not just monitors it. The combination of support for industrial protocols like Modbus, DNP3, and OPC with multiscanning across 30 antivirus engines and deep CDR file sanitization covers both the OT/IT boundary problem and supply chain risk simultaneously, addressing NIST GV.SC and PR.DS priorities that most network segmentation tools leave incomplete. Skip this if you need bidirectional communication for remote diagnostics or if your OT environment runs predominantly proprietary protocols that MetaDefender hasn't certified yet; unidirectional gateways are a design choice, not a limitation to work around.
Enterprise and mid-market security teams protecting critical infrastructure from lateral movement will find the Owl OPDS-100's hardware-enforced one-way data transfer uniquely valuable when network segmentation must survive active compromise. The 1U form factor and physical data diode design deliver the PR.IR control maturity that pure software segmentation cannot guarantee, especially in OT environments where the cost of failure justifies appliance-class hardware. Pass if your throughput demands exceed low-to-moderate rates or if you need east-west microsegmentation across hundreds of internal pathways; this tool is built for perimeter hardening and critical asset protection, not general-purpose network slicing.

OPSWAT MetaDefender NetWall: Data diode & security gateway for secure unidirectional OT/IT data transfer. built by OPSWAT. headquartered in United States. Core capabilities include Hardware-enforced unidirectional data flow with no return path, Support for industrial protocols including Modbus, OPC, MQTT, IEC104, DNP3, Selectable throughput from 5 Mbps to 10 Gbps..
Owl OPDS-100: 1U rack-mountable data diode for one-way data transfer security. built by owl cyber. headquartered in United States. Core capabilities include Hardware-enforced one-way data transfer, 1U rack-mountable form factor, Physical network segmentation..
